1. Executive Snapshot
Core Offering Overview
Lazy 2.0 represents a paradigm shift in knowledge capture and management, positioning itself as the ultimate solution for eliminating context switching while maintaining productive workflows. Developed by Lazy Labs Inc under the leadership of CEO Ahmed Menouni, this innovative platform combines universal content capture with AI-powered conversational interaction, creating what the company describes as a “thinking partner grounded in your own knowledge.”
The platform operates on a fundamental principle that traditional note-taking applications fail to address the core challenge of capturing information without disrupting workflow. Lazy 2.0 solves this through a single keyboard shortcut that enables users to capture content from any source while simultaneously offering AI-powered insights and connections to existing knowledge.
Built around the core functionality of instant capture and intelligent organization, Lazy 2.0 transforms how professionals, creatives, and knowledge workers interact with information across their digital environments. The platform captures content from websites, YouTube videos, PDFs, emails, and social media platforms while maintaining contextual metadata and automatic organization.
Key Achievements \& Milestones
Since launching its original version, Lazy has achieved significant recognition within the productivity and knowledge management space. The platform previously won a Golden Kitty award on Product Hunt, establishing its credibility in the competitive note-taking market. This recognition validated the company’s innovative approach to solving context switching challenges.
The launch of Lazy 2.0 in July 2025 marked a substantial evolution from basic capture functionality to AI-enhanced knowledge interaction. The new version introduced conversational AI capabilities that enable users to query their captured knowledge, compare information across sources, and receive contextual insights based on their personal knowledge base.
The platform has garnered endorsements from notable productivity experts and content creators, including recognition from Shu Omi, who described it as potentially “the best Mac note-taker of 2024.” The application has been featured in multiple technology reviews and productivity-focused YouTube channels, consistently receiving praise for its innovative capture experience.

9. Transparent Pricing
Plan Tiers \& Cost Breakdown
Lazy 2.0 operates on a subscription-based pricing model with early access pricing currently set at \$12.50 per month when billed annually. The pricing structure reflects the platform’s positioning as a premium productivity tool that delivers significant value through its unique capabilities.
The current pricing includes full access to all capture capabilities, unlimited AI interactions, cross-device synchronization, and all premium features without usage restrictions or artificial limitations. This comprehensive approach ensures users can fully explore the platform’s capabilities without concern about incremental costs.
Early adopters benefit from locked-in pricing that protects against future rate increases, providing long-term value security for committed users who recognize the platform’s potential for transforming their knowledge management workflows.

10. Market Positioning
Platform | Primary Focus | Pricing (Monthly) | Key Differentiator | AI Features | Cross-Platform | Target Users |
---|---|---|---|---|---|---|
Lazy 2.0 | Universal capture with AI chat | \$12.50 | Context-aware AI + universal capture | Context-aware chat, summarization | macOS, iOS, Web | Knowledge workers, creatives |
Obsidian | Local note network with links | Free / \$16 sync | Local files + extensive plugins | Community AI plugins | All platforms | Power users, researchers |
Notion | All-in-one workspace | Free / \$8+ | Database + collaboration features | Notion AI (GPT integration) | All platforms | Teams, project managers |
Reflect | Networked thought with AI | \$10 | Calendar integration + AI | Built-in AI chat | All platforms | Individual knowledge workers |
Mem | AI-enhanced personal memory | \$8 | AI-powered memory assistance | AI tagging and search | All platforms | Personal knowledge management |
Roam Research | Networked note-taking | \$15 | Block-based networked notes | Limited AI features | All platforms | Researchers, academics |
Logseq | Open-source knowledge graph | Free | Privacy-focused + open source | Limited AI features | All platforms | Privacy-conscious users |
Evernote | Web clipper and organization | \$15 | Robust web clipper | Basic AI search | All platforms | General note-takers |
Apple Notes | Simple note-taking | Free | Native iOS/macOS integration | None | Apple ecosystem only | Apple users |
Otter.ai | Meeting transcription \& notes | Free / \$8.33+ | Real-time meeting transcription | AI transcription and summaries | All platforms | Meeting-heavy professionals |
